Building a paver walkway in Escondido involves precise steps, starting with marking the exact path and excavating the soil to the correct depth. This ensures a stable foundation for your new walkway. The next critical phase involves laying down and thoroughly compacting a layer of aggregate base material. This provides drainage and structural integrity, essential for Escondido's climate. A finely graded layer of sand follows, acting as a leveling bed for the pavers themselves. Licensed pros then carefully place each paver, meticulously cutting them to fit intricate patterns or curves. The final step is sweeping polymeric sand into the joints, which hardens to lock the pavers securely. About this service

A retractable awning is a mounted shade system that extends or retracts to manage sunlight on your deck or patio. You need one if you want the flexibility to enjoy your outdoor space in the sun or retreat into the shade during the hottest parts of the day. They help reduce heat buildup near your windows and protect outdoor furniture from fading. What makes a good paver base for Escondido patios?

A proper paver base in Escondido typically consists of compacted crushed stone or aggregate. This layer provides drainage and prevents settling, which is vital for longevity. The thickness of the base depends on the intended use of the patio and local soil conditions. A well-prepared base is key to a lasting installation.
